Catherine Colby
Founder and Teacher
Graduated San Diego State University with a BA in Music, Dance, Theatre. She has taught classes in music, theater, musical theatre, improv, vocal production, preschool and creative movement to kids ages 3 to 18. She sang in choirs from elementary school through college and has been in numerous shows. She began teaching in Solana Beach as "Rising Stars Studio." She was hired as the music teacher for Park Dale Lane Elementary School and was then hired as the theatre teacher at Encinitas Country Day School. She left the school system when her kids were toddlers and created "Mini Theatre Troupe." (Later changing the name to Music & Theatre Troupe.) She has directed hundreds of musicals & plays from mini preschool shows performing in a corner of the preschool classroom to big Broadway musicals performed on the big stage with lights, sound, backdrops, set changes, rotating stages, costumes, props, and live music. With years of teaching experience, she knows how to teach while keeping it fun and how to set her students up for success. It’s her mission of meeting kids where they are and keeping it meaningful and fun (& onstage) that sets the climate for MTT.

Julie Greathouse-Suazo
Casting Director
Julie started her musical theatre career in the Cleveland theatrical community as a child performer in the sixties and has been working steadily since. A lifelong musician and veteran performer of numerous local productions, regional theatre, and national touring, she also works independently as a musical director, vocal director, theatrical script doctor, casting consultant, private audition and vocal coach, and as a music curriculum consultant. Julie has also worked in San Diego and La Jolla school districts teaching general music, recorders, K-3 percussion band, musical theatre, and theatre arts since 1987. She has been working with several local school districts, providing site-embedded staff development for general music to classroom teachers in the primary grades.

Julia Giolzetti
Guest Teacher
Julia Giolzetti was lucky enough to begin her theatre journey in the classroom at age 8. She holds a BFA in Theatre from NYU’s Tisch School of the Arts. For 2 years and almost 400 shows she performed Off-Broadway with the New York Times Critic’s Pick Drunk Shakespeare. Other New York theatre credits include over 15 Shakespeare plays, originating roles in 3 world premieres, and ad campaigns for Bank of America. She taught youth theatre workshops in NYC for many years and also worked as a one-on-one monologue coach. In addition, she led classes as supplements to performances with the all-female ensemble the Tempest Ladies in Istanbul, Turkey. Here in San Diego, she has taught at San Diego Junior Theatre, North Coast Rep, in many county classrooms with Playwrights Project, and toured multiple Shakespeare productions in local schools. During the lockdowns of 2020, Julia created Sofa Shakespeare, a global project where anyone can perform 1 minute of a Shakespeare play from home.
